Nie jesteś zalogowany.
Jeśli nie posiadasz konta, zarejestruj je już teraz! Pozwoli Ci ono w pełni korzystać z naszego serwisu. Spamerom dziękujemy!

Ogłoszenie

Prosimy o pomoc dla małej Julki — przekaż 1% podatku na Fundacji Dzieciom zdazyć z Pomocą.
Więcej informacji na dug.net.pl/pomagamy/.

#1  2016-08-25 13:04:52

  ramai - Użytkownik

ramai
Użytkownik
Zarejestrowany: 2016-08-25

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

Witam Wszystkich!!

Na forum jestem nowy, choć dużo wiedzy z niego zaczerpnąłem. Moja znajomość systemu raczej średnia, ciągle się uczę.

serwer to NAS D-link DNS-320
zainstalowany DEBIAN 7.11

Po instalacji OwnCloud'a zastosowałem skrypt do zmiany uprawnień, według zaleceń na stronie owncloud, od tego czasu zaczęły się problemy.

Kod:

The easy way to set the correct permissions is to copy and run this script. Replace the ocpath variable with the path to your ownCloud directory, and replace the htuser and htgroup variables with your HTTP user and group:

#!/bin/bash
ocpath='/var/www/owncloud'
htuser='www-data'
htgroup='www-data'
rootuser='root'


find ${ocpath}/ -type f -print0 | xargs -0 chmod 0640
find ${ocpath}/ -type d -print0 | xargs -0 chmod 0750

chown -R ${rootuser}:${htgroup} ${ocpath}/
chown -R ${htuser}:${htgroup} ${ocpath}/apps/
chown -R ${htuser}:${htgroup} ${ocpath}/config/
chown -R ${htuser}:${htgroup} ${ocpath}/data/
chown -R ${htuser}:${htgroup} ${ocpath}/themes/

chown ${rootuser}:${htgroup} ${ocpath}/.htaccess
chown ${rootuser}:${htgroup} ${ocpath}/data/.htaccess

chmod 0644 ${ocpath}/.htaccess
chmod 0644 ${ocpath}/data/.htaccess

po wykonaniu skryptu nie mam kontroli nad systemem - root bez praw. po wywołaniu ssh mam logowanie, ale sesja się zamyka po wpisaniu hasła. jedynie logowanie do serwera mogę przeprowadzić przez webmina, lecz nie mogę odpalić konsolii:

Kod:

Ajaxterm did not start accepting connections on port 10001 after 30 seconds.

- webmin daję mi możliwość zarządzania użytkownikami i grupami, ale po założeniu nowego usera z prawami root UID=0, GID=0 i zmianach w passwd

Kod:

newroot::0:0:/home/newroot:/bin/bash

niewiele to zmiania. mogę przez webmina uploadować pliki. oczywiście lista ograniczeń jest baaaaardzo długa, po krótce:
- nie widzę procesów
-nie mogę wykonać żadnego polecenia z poziomu linii poleceń w webminie :(
- serwer stoi na NAS D-Link -320, więc klawiatury nie podłączę  :(
- system to Debian 7.11
- brak możliwości zalogowania się do panelu webowego d-linka - "500 - Internal Server Error"
- winscp - podobnie jak ssh - mam okno logowania ale dostaje komunikat "Nie można zainicjować protokołu SFTP. Czy na hoście działa serwer SFTP?" (działa!!)

ręce mi opadły i nie powiem jeszcze co. liczę się z tym że jest to koniec , ale mam jeszcze cień nadziei że jakiś "mistrz" coś wyczaruje :)
problem opisany również na forum debian.pl - chwilowo brak wskazówek :(

Offline

 

#2  2016-08-25 13:50:36

  uzytkownikubunt - Zbanowany

uzytkownikubunt
Zbanowany
Zarejestrowany: 2012-04-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

3138

Ostatnio edytowany przez uzytkownikubunt (2016-12-01 01:43:39)

Offline

 

#3  2016-08-25 15:39:50

  ramai - Użytkownik

ramai
Użytkownik
Zarejestrowany: 2016-08-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

sprawdzać mogę i zmieniać uprawnienia (z poziomu webmina, pokazuje że zmienił)
/bin/bash 0644
/bin/sh 0644

Offline

 

#4  2016-08-25 15:55:35

  uzytkownikubunt - Zbanowany

uzytkownikubunt
Zbanowany
Zarejestrowany: 2012-04-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

3140

Ostatnio edytowany przez uzytkownikubunt (2016-12-01 01:43:41)

Offline

 

#5  2016-08-25 20:31:40

  ramai - Użytkownik

ramai
Użytkownik
Zarejestrowany: 2016-08-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

niestety przy zmianie uprawnień webmin pokazuję że zmienił na 0755, ale po przeładowaniu jest 0644 :( i ssh nie robi.

Kod:

permissions have been changed successfully, but not for all objects:
bash - failedto change permissions: -1

Ostatnio edytowany przez ramai (2016-08-25 20:38:09)

Offline

 

#6  2016-08-25 20:38:40

  uzytkownikubunt - Zbanowany

uzytkownikubunt
Zbanowany
Zarejestrowany: 2012-04-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

3141

Ostatnio edytowany przez uzytkownikubunt (2016-12-01 01:43:42)

Offline

 

#7  2016-08-25 21:08:20

  jawojx - Użytkownik

jawojx
Użytkownik
Zarejestrowany: 2012-10-11

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

A dlaczego nie chcesz zresetować do ustawień fabrycznych (przyciskiem z tyłu) i zacząć wszystko od nowa ustawić.

Offline

 

#8  2016-08-25 22:03:31

  ramai - Użytkownik

ramai
Użytkownik
Zarejestrowany: 2016-08-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

reset i walka od początku to ostateczność ....
dziękuję za pomoc.

Offline

 

#9  2016-08-29 12:08:04

  ramai - Użytkownik

ramai
Użytkownik
Zarejestrowany: 2016-08-25

Re: Owncloud - skrypt do zmiany uprawnień zablokował dostęp do systemu

już po reinstalacji, ownclouda już nie instaluję. dziękuję za wsparcie

Offline

 

Stopka forum

Powered by PunBB
© Copyright 2002–2005 Rickard Andersson
Możesz wyłączyć AdBlock — tu nie ma reklam ;-)

[ Generated in 0.015 seconds, 12 queries executed ]

Informacje debugowania

Time (s) Query
0.00014 SET CHARSET latin2
0.00004 SET NAMES latin2
0.00155 SELECT u.*, g.*, o.logged FROM punbb_users AS u INNER JOIN punbb_groups AS g ON u.group_id=g.g_id LEFT JOIN punbb_online AS o ON o.ident='13.59.2.242' WHERE u.id=1
0.00095 REPLACE INTO punbb_online (user_id, ident, logged) VALUES(1, '13.59.2.242', 1732747976)
0.00055 SELECT * FROM punbb_online WHERE logged<1732747676
0.00111 DELETE FROM punbb_online WHERE ident='54.36.149.81'
0.00080 SELECT topic_id FROM punbb_posts WHERE id=304549
0.00007 SELECT id FROM punbb_posts WHERE topic_id=28890 ORDER BY posted
0.00075 SELECT t.subject, t.closed, t.num_replies, t.sticky, f.id AS forum_id, f.forum_name, f.moderators, fp.post_replies, 0 FROM punbb_topics AS t INNER JOIN punbb_forums AS f ON f.id=t.forum_id LEFT JOIN punbb_forum_perms AS fp ON (fp.forum_id=f.id AND fp.group_id=3) WHERE (fp.read_forum IS NULL OR fp.read_forum=1) AND t.id=28890 AND t.moved_to IS NULL
0.00005 SELECT search_for, replace_with FROM punbb_censoring
0.00254 SELECT u.email, u.title, u.url, u.location, u.use_avatar, u.signature, u.email_setting, u.num_posts, u.registered, u.admin_note, p.id, p.poster AS username, p.poster_id, p.poster_ip, p.poster_email, p.message, p.hide_smilies, p.posted, p.edited, p.edited_by, g.g_id, g.g_user_title, o.user_id AS is_online FROM punbb_posts AS p INNER JOIN punbb_users AS u ON u.id=p.poster_id INNER JOIN punbb_groups AS g ON g.g_id=u.group_id LEFT JOIN punbb_online AS o ON (o.user_id=u.id AND o.user_id!=1 AND o.idle=0) WHERE p.topic_id=28890 ORDER BY p.id LIMIT 0,25
0.00172 UPDATE punbb_topics SET num_views=num_views+1 WHERE id=28890
Total query time: 0.01027 s